A leading IT services provider in Southampton seeks a Desktop Support Analyst to deliver high‑quality technical support and ensure exceptional customer satisfaction.
Responsibilities include:
- Responding to IT tickets
- Supporting Microsoft applications
- Maintaining meeting room technology
The ideal candidate has strong communication skills and full rights to work in the UK. This full-time role offers competitive benefits and a supportive work environ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Acora - IT, Cyber & AI
✨Know Your Tech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of both Mac and Windows systems, as well as any AV technology mentioned in the job description. Be prepared to discuss common issues and solutions you've encountered in previous roles.
✨Show Off Your Communication Skills
Since strong communication is key for this role, practice explaining technical concepts in simple terms. You might be asked to demonstrate how you would assist a non-technical user, so think about examples from your past experiences.
✨Familiarise Yourself with IT Ticketing Systems
Get to grips with common IT ticketing systems and processes. If you have experience with specific tools, be ready to share how you used them to improve efficiency or customer satisfaction in your previous jobs.
✨Prepare Questions About the Role
Have a few thoughtful questions ready to ask at the end of your interview. This shows your interest in the position and helps you gauge if the company culture aligns with your values, especially regarding support and teamwork.
